Will Smith on 75% Tax in France: 'God Bless America!'


(CNSNews.com) – France’s Socialist president, Francois Hollande, has proposed rasing the tax rate to 75 percent on income above 1 million euros ($1.24 million) a year, a proposal that liberal actor Will Smith expressed surprise over – but did not disagree with – when asked about it earlier this year.

On France’s TF1 in early May, Smith explained why he supported the idea of paying higher taxes, saying, "I have no issue with paying taxes and whatever needs to be done for my country to grow. I believe very firmly that my ability to sit here -- I'm a black man who didn't go to college, yet I get to travel around the world and sell my movies, and I believe very firmly that America is the only place on Earth that I could exist. So I will pay anything that I need to pay to keep my country growing."
